Frodo || 9 Years || Male || Strays United Scavenger || M: Ash (pg 24), Open

Many days have passed since Frodo began his journey through this stretch of wilderness. A ravine split in twin by a winding river, both of which had seemingly cut through the mountains themselves. It was quite the interesting place, if you asked him. A sight to behold. If it weren’t for the rank stench of wolf (a smell he had become familiar with over time), he’d honestly enjoy this stretch of the trip. Not that it was a reason for concern. He could handle a wolf. He had before, many times… not in any physical fights, of course, but still.

Mistakenly, he takes a deeper breath than unusual as he pads his tiny paws down the bank. Not for any particular or urgent reason, though. Just the desire to breathe in the fresh scent of leaves and smell for any nearby source of food. The fawn and black mutt huffs out a harsh breath – one akin to a sneeze – immediately afterwards. Not a drop of clean air had entered his lungs. Just the nose-burning scent of wolf. Then again, he did seem to be in pack territory, so he shouldn’t be surprised.

With a heavily annoyed grumble, the min pin mix shakes his head gently – a vain attempt to rid his nostrils of that horrid smell. His paws continue to slap against the slightly moist river bank as he does so, following it southward for no real reason than the movement behind his paws. His ears were on a constant swivel as he moved, keeping a literal ear out for any noise that could hint at something off in the near vicinity. One could never be too cautious out in the wilds, after all.

His large ears caught nothing out of the ordinary, much to his glee. (No blasted critter is sneakin’ up on me taday!) But what they did catch, besides the natural ambiance of the surrounding area, was the rumbling of his empty stomach. He cringes at the sound and feeling. Though, it was a… good reminder that he had yet to eat all day. Albeit, an unpleasant one.

Pinning his slightly ears back, he shifts himself to where his head and neck were facing the stretch of territory before him – a paw lifted into the air as his shoulders partially follow the aforementioned movements. It would not be wise nor smart of him to venture into wolf territory for a snack. Even if he was “starving” and in need of sustenance.

For some time (which was really only a couple of minutes), he just stays in that position, arguing with himself over whether or not it would be worth it to even think about heading into this area. Though, it did not take much time for his stomach to remind him of both his needs as well as age. Blasted, old-aged metabolism. Always hits me at the wrong time.

With a silent growl, the small canine begins his journey into wolf territory – his alertness raised to its max. He constantly stiffs the area as he moves, both keeping a “lookout” for any danger and prey. Eventually, he picks up on a trail of pika and begins to follow it.

Paw over paw. Step over stone. Scuttle under root. Weave through grass. He did it all in the name of finding that delectable snack that he would soon be calling his. Finally, after huffing and puffing his way through the landscape, he spots it. Munching on a seed of some sorts, right in front of a large rock that was surrounded by many other smaller stones. An opening could be seen not far from where it was. Likely its burrow.

A fat one, it was. Well fed. Strong. And young (meaning it was undoubtedly spry). But, an easy catch. All that fluff it was carrying would slow it down. Its attention was completely centered on that source of feel as well. It wouldn’t be too tricky to sneak up on it. But, then again, his breed wasn’t really known for stealth.

Skirting around the front of the rock, Frodo – rather quickly – “stalks” around to the other side where the pika’s back was facing. His form was strong and mostly upright, with only his raised hackles and lowered head (which was in line with his spine now) being signs of any change. His steps were not slow at all, but they still held the same methodical air to them that most stalking stances did.

An ear twitch. The miniscule dog freezes in place, a paw hanging into the air in anticipation. He was directly behind the pika now. But that wouldn’t guarantee him the meal.

A lifted head. It was sniffing the air now. And the wind was not in his favor. If he was going to act, he had to act now.

The flash of a twisting head. It was too late for the small mammal now. His attack launched the minute its head had begun to turn, easily crossing the threshold of its burrow before it even knew what was going on. Paws and long claws dug unto the ground beneath him and he dashed towards the rodent, flinging up debris as he did.

The scrambling of small paws. The pika could only move but a mere stride, its paws having lost any traction it could have gained in its panic. The male’s teeth sink into its back soon after its pathetic attempt at running. Nearly sliding to a stop, he thrashes his head and upper to and fro, ending his meal’s life in a rather quick manner. He always made sure that whatever he killed did not have to suffer. If he could help it.

The shaking of his head and body halt the moment he knows his head. His prize dangles from his maw, its taste slipping onto his tongue. The tantalizing offer to just eat it where he stood pops into his mind, but he stands against it.

Would not be very beneficial for my health to eat it on the territory of another. Best to head back ta the river and munch on it there.

Turning around, he moves to head back to where he once traveled… only to be stopped in his tracks in an instant. Before him now stood a young wolf, fit with dark gray fur and white and silver markings. And, telling by the canine’s scent, he belonged to the pack of this very area.

Drat.

Placing his pika on the ground (as he was undoubtedly spotted) he goes to speak, “Sorry for the intrusion, Sonny. Name’s Frodo. I was just wandering ‘round this neck of the woods when I got a bit peckish. Hope I didn’t bother ya too much by huntin’ here. Ya can take my catch, if ya’d like.”
